660 - Chocolate Mousse Pie

(by Shirley McNevich)


1 Keebler graham cracker crust (regular OR chocolate)
1 1/2 cups milk
1 envelope unflavored gelatin
1 - 6oz. bag Nestle's semi-sweet chocolate bits
1 tsp. vanilla
2 cups Cool Whip (thawed)

In a saucepan add the milk. Sprinkle the gelatin over the top of the milk, and then let
it stand for 1 minute. Turn heat on low and stir until gelatin is dissolved (about 5
minutes). Add the chocolate bits and keep stirring over low heat until all bits are
melted. Stir in the vanilla. Remove from heat and cool for 1 hour, stirring occasionally.
When mixture mounds on your spoon, it's ready. Add the Cool Whip to the chocolate
mixture and fold it in with a spoon until mixed. Pour mixture into pre-made crust.
Refrigerate overnight before serving.
